North Projects is proud to be contributing to the Connect PNG Economic Road Infrastructure Programme, a transformative 20-year initiative designed to deliver 100% road connectivity across Papua New Guinea by 2040. This flagship programme, launched under the Connect PNG Act 2021, represents one of the most ambitious infrastructure undertakings in the region, with a commitment to build 16,500 kilometres of roads and establish 14 key economic corridors linking communities across Papua New Guinea.
The Connect PNG Programme is more than a road-building project – it is a catalyst for economic growth, social inclusion, and sustainable development. By improving access to essential services such as health and education, and enabling the movement of goods and people, the programme will unlock opportunities for rural and urban communities alike. It also serves as a foundation for other enabling infrastructure, including electricity and ICT, supporting resource development projects and broader national growth.
